South Shore Golf Course
About
| Tee | Par | Length | Rating | Slope |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Back | 72 | 6268 yards | 70.0 | 123 |
| Middle | 72 | 5815 yards | 67.8 | 117 |
| Forward (W) | 72 | 5061 yards | 68.5 | 115 |
| Hole | 1 | 2 | 3 | 4 | 5 | 6 | 7 | 8 | 9 | Out | 10 | 11 | 12 | 13 | 14 | 15 | 16 | 17 | 18 | In | Total |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Blue M: 70.0/123 | 411 | 457 | 293 | 272 | 551 | 141 | 370 | 157 | 533 | 3185 | 348 | 399 | 451 | 357 | 162 | 401 | 379 | 219 | 367 | 3083 | 6268 |
| White M: 67.8/117 W: 73.9/131 | 372 | 434 | 248 | 265 | 529 | 115 | 340 | 148 | 514 | 2965 | 306 | 384 | 417 | 346 | 130 | 377 | 360 | 187 | 343 | 2850 | 5815 |
| Red W: 69.4/121 | 338 | 345 | 239 | 257 | 439 | 84 | 313 | 130 | 454 | 2599 | 256 | 346 | 408 | 329 | 110 | 281 | 334 | 125 | 273 | 2462 | 5061 |
| Handicap | 3 | 9 | 11 | 17 | 1 | 15 | 7 | 13 | 5 | 10 | 4 | 12 | 16 | 18 | 6 | 2 | 8 | 14 | |||
| Par | 4 | 5 | 4 | 4 | 5 | 3 | 4 | 3 | 5 | 37 | 4 | 4 | 5 | 4 | 3 | 4 | 4 | 3 | 4 | 35 | 72 |
| Handicap (W) | 7 | 9 | 11 | 13 | 1 | 17 | 5 | 15 | 3 | 16 | 6 | 2 | 8 | 18 | 12 | 4 | 10 | 14 |

Course in Disrepair
Unfortunately South Shore Golf Couse is in desperate need of repair, cleanup and restoration. The couse has been in steady decline for quite a few years. The cart paths, sand traps haven’t been repaired and there is quite a bit of trash lining the wooded areas. There were not enough golf carts on Sunday, so there was a wait, but that might be expected on a busy weekend. The golf carts themselves are very torn up and need big time rehab or better yet, full replacement. The mens rest room have 2 broken urinals an a sink which have been out of order for several months. The personnel at the food concession are always friendly and accommodating,, but this concession is not always open during normal golf hours, so bring your own coffee and snacks to be safe. The bottom line is that this course should be in mint condition given the greens fees being charged. It used to be one of the pearls of Staten Island. It needs a tremendous amount of attention to get back to where it was several years ago.

The Good , the bad
Mid April golf with rain and cold weather not conducive to plush grass The course was in decent shape. Fairways had some bare spots but you were able to find some decent grass in area of your ball. Low lying areas were wet but salvageable.
Greens were recently aerated so a bit sandy and hard Tee boxes while not great have started to grow in and are alot better than the last 2 seasons. The carts are preposterous and are beat to crap. All in all , I grabbed a hot deal and paid $45 for a 10 am tee time so 18 holes with cart under $50 these days are rare. If I’m paid the standard $70+ I may not have been so nice in my review. Staff is great if only AGC would put some $$$ into SSGC it would be a great place and keep locals from going to NJ. Oh, and I played with Matty B !
